Tragic Israeli Drone Strike Claims Lives of 3 in Southern Lebanon

The ongoing tensions in the region have escalated significantly, particularly with recent incidents involving Israeli drone strikes in Lebanon. Reports indicate that an Israeli drone targeted a vehicle in the al-Dabash neighborhood, located east of Yohmor al-Shaqif, accompanied by artillery shelling. This attack highlights the increasing aggression in the area, raising concerns about further escalation.

According to Al Mayadeen’s correspondent, the situation remains dire as the region continues to experience violence. Earlier in the day, a Lebanese citizen tragically lost his life due to an Israeli drone strike on his vehicle in the town of Maaroub, situated in the Tyre district. This incident is part of a broader pattern of aggression that has intensified over recent days.
